Flatulence is passing gas from the digestive system out of the back passage. It's more commonly known as 'passing wind', or 'farting'.Excessive flatulence can be caused by swallowing more air than usual or eating food that's difficult to digest. It can also be related to an underlying health problem affecting the digestive system.
